| Aspect | Definition | Audience Effect | Example in Practice |
|---|---|---|---|
| Narrative Authority | Omniscient narrator holds complete knowledge of events, thoughts, and outcomes. | Readers gain trust through reliable context and reduced ambiguity. | Historical drama where the narrator explains unspoken motives. |
| Scope of Awareness | Scope extends across time, location, and character boundaries. | Enables cross-thread tension and layered storytelling. | Crime series linking past investigations to present suspects. |
| Character Distance | Narrative may hover close to one protagonist or rotate freely. | Balances intimacy with breadth, supporting ensemble dynamics. | Fantasy epic shifting focus between kingdoms and exiles. |
| Thematic Resonance | Omniscience reinforces themes such as fate, irony, and truth. | Deepens subtext and intellectual engagement. | Dystopian satire contrasting character beliefs with narrator facts. |
Structure and Pacing in Omniscient Narratives
Designing narrative rhythm requires deliberate control over information release. Writers choose when to reveal backstory, foreshadow consequences, or maintain ambiguity.
Strategic chapter breaks and transitions let the omniscient reader cast shift smoothly between perspectives without disorienting the audience.
Character Development Across Perspectives
An omniscient narrator can expose contradictions between public actions and private doubts, enriching character complexity.
Supporting figures benefit from layered context, as readers understand how their choices affect the broader story network.
Audience Engagement and Suspense
Knowing more than the characters creates dramatic irony, where tension arises from anticipation rather than shock alone.
Skilled deployment of hints allows viewers to feel ahead of events while still being surprised by execution.
Worldbuilding and Continuity Management
Consistent rules, history, and cause-effect relationships are easier to maintain when narrative oversight is centralized.
Creators use structured timelines and cross-referenced details to avoid contradictions across long arcs.
